Subject: Crash-report pipeline cut-over complete

Team — the cut-over of the Pellwright crash-report pipeline to the new ingest cluster finished at 06:40 this morning. Symbolication is now handled inline, and the legacy uploader has been disabled on all mobile builds going forward. Older app versions will keep posting to the shim endpoint until end of month. If you get paged, check ingest lag first. The production configuration now in effect is shown below.

settings of tagef-bawif:
DRUIX_HOST=druix.zemvarlabs.internal
DRUIX_PORT=8000

Subject: FD-leak cut-over done on Porchlight

Hi Mara,

Quick wrap-up: the descriptor-leak hunt on Porchlight is over. The new tracked-handle wrapper went live last night, old pool drained cleanly, and open-FD counts have been flat for twelve hours — a first since the Kestrel release. One hiccup with the log shipper holding sockets, now fixed. We can close the incident. The wrapper runs with these settings in production.

deployment values, yadug-bawif:
[framir]
team = pelox
access_code = ac_a38ab2
owner = tamion.julael
host = framir.tolvaqlabs.test
port = 11211
peer = tammir.zemvargrid.local
salt = 2215ef03
pin = 1541

### Migration Guide — Step 2: Point snapshot tests at the Glassframe renderer

If you're new to the Pellinor UI repo, note that snapshot tests previously rendered against the legacy DOM shim, which tolerated nondeterministic attribute ordering. Glassframe does not, so stale snapshots will fail loudly after this step — that's expected; regenerate them rather than hand-editing. Before regenerating, make sure your local runner matches CI exactly, or you'll churn snapshots forever. Set your runner to the following configuration values.

service settings:
druael:
  log_level: error
  metrics_host: metrics.druael.tolvaqlabs.internal
  pool_size: 16

**Runbook: incremental rebuilds (Fernbright static pipeline)**

Incremental rebuilds only fire when the content hash cache is warm; a cold cache forces a full rebuild and blows the sync window. Before kicking the job, confirm `REBUILD_MODE=incremental` and that the cache volume mounted cleanly. The rebuild worker also authenticates to the asset store, so the env file needs the store's access secret on the line right after the mode flag.

vault entry, yahif-yajep: COURIER_KEY29=b802bdf8034096b65a51c6ba5abe2